Fred Neil.... you have to love him. it's not just us; David Crosby, John Sebastian, Paul Kantner, Stephen Stills and a whole skipload of superstars were inspired by Fred, and remain absolutely besotted fans!!!Yes, once more we proudly present the genius of Fred Neil. This time live! But we include not only the studio/live album, "Other Side Of This Life" (itself the remnant of a grandiose live/duets project) but, get this; FOUR completely forgotten songs from a live show at the Bitter End club in 1963 (just before the recording of his debut album with Vince Martin for Elektra!), Fred's first released recordings! These songs were only ever released on a various artists folk compilation and seemingly were completely forgotten!! They have never re-emerged! A major rediscovery? You bet!!!!! A snapshot of the Greenwich Village folk scene before anyone was anyone? Oh yes! Together with a 1971 show in front of an audience of music business luminaries and superstar fans, AND the remnants of the duets section, featuring David Crosby, Gram Parsons, Stephen Stills, Vince Martin - Fred's last released recordings! Fred Neil was the eminence grise of 1960's Folkrock....the most famous unknown songwriter in the world....a reclusive, truculent man, who vehemently shied away from stardom....so admired by his contemporaries that his songs are everywhere covered....by Buddy Holly, Roy Orbison, the Lovin' Spoonful, Tim Buckley, Jefferson Airplane (who also wrote two songs *about* Fred!)....and most famously I suppose by Harry Nilsson, whose megahit cover of "Everybody's Talking" (from the soundtrack of "Midnight Cowboy") means that Fred Neil is the writer of one of the seven most played songs in the world!....Not bad for a man who deliberately retreated from fame at the height of his powers to pursue Dolphin research! "He taught me everything that was music" says David Crosby....and here are some of his best recordings, produced for Capitol by Nik Venet, the almost-pop-structured "Fred Neil" album, and it's experimental follow up "Sessions".....Pure genius....I quite seriously defy anyone not to love Fred Neil!
